Pine Campground

Pine Campground is situated in an open area with some pine and fir on Anderson Ranch Reservoir. The reservoir offers water skiing and fishing for trout, bass, and Kokanee Salmon. Hiking, mountain bike, and ATV trails are nearby. Wildlife present in the area include deer, elk, mountain lions, and black bears.

Facilities: Pine Campground provides restrooms and drinking water.

Reservations: Reservations are not needed or accepted for Pine Campground.

Best Time To Visit: Pine Campground is open May through October.

Fees: An overnight fee is charged.

Accessibility: This campground is not handicap accessible.

Rules: The maximum length of stay is 14 days.

Directions: To reach Pine Campground from Mountain Home, travel northeast on U.S> Highway 20 about 30 miles to Forest Highway 61. Travel northeast on Forest Highway 61 about 15 miles to reach the campground.
